What Tools Are Used for Custom iOS App Development?

Building a successful iPhone application requires more than writing code. Developers need the right tools to design attractive interfaces, create reliable features, test app performance, and prepare the product for launch. Choosing the correct development tools also helps businesses reduce technical problems and deliver a better user experience.

Apple provides a complete development ecosystem for building applications across its platforms. Its official developer resources include Xcode, Swift, SwiftUI, testing frameworks, performance tools, and distribution services. These tools support the complete app development process, from the first design idea to App Store release.

1. Xcode: The Main iOS Development Environment

Xcode is Apple’s official integrated development environment, also known as an IDE. It is the primary tool used by developers to write, build, debug, test, and distribute iOS applications.

Xcode includes several useful features, such as:

  • Source code editing
  • Code completion
  • Debugging tools
  • iOS Simulator
  • Performance analysis
  • App archiving and distribution
  • Interface previews

For most custom iOS application development services, Xcode is the central tool used throughout the project.

2. Swift: The Main Programming Language

Swift is Apple’s modern programming language for developing applications across iOS, iPadOS, macOS, watchOS, and other Apple platforms.

Swift is designed to be fast, secure, and easier to read than many traditional programming languages. It supports modern programming practices and helps developers create stable applications with fewer common coding errors.

A custom iOS app development company may use Swift to build features such as user accounts, payment systems, notifications, dashboards, and API integrations.

3. SwiftUI: A Modern UI Development Framework

SwiftUI is Apple’s framework for creating app interfaces with a declarative coding approach. Instead of describing every step of how the interface should change, developers describe what the interface should look like based on the current app state.

SwiftUI helps developers create:

  • Buttons and forms
  • Navigation screens
  • Lists and dashboards
  • Animations
  • Responsive layouts
  • Light and dark mode interfaces

It can help reduce repetitive interface code and make design updates easier during custom iOS app development.

4. UIKit: For Advanced Interface Control

UIKit is another important framework used to build iOS interfaces. It provides detailed control over screens, navigation, gestures, animations, tables, and other interface elements.

Although SwiftUI is widely used for modern projects, UIKit remains valuable for complex applications, older codebases, and situations that require highly customized user interfaces.

5. iOS Simulator: Testing Without Every Device

The iOS Simulator allows developers to test an application on simulated Apple devices without needing every physical iPhone model.

Developers can use it to check:

  • Screen layouts
  • Different screen sizes
  • Device orientations
  • Location changes
  • Memory warnings
  • Network conditions
  • App behavior across supported iOS versions

However, real-device testing is still important because a simulator cannot reproduce every hardware and performance condition.

6. XCTest and Swift Testing: Quality Assurance Tools

Testing frameworks help developers identify problems before an app reaches customers. XCTest supports unit testing, UI testing, and performance testing. Swift Testing provides modern tools for writing expressive tests.

These frameworks help verify that app features work correctly and continue working after updates.

7. Instruments: Improving App Performance

Instruments is included with Xcode and helps developers analyze application performance. It can identify problems related to CPU usage, memory, battery consumption, disk activity, and slow user interfaces.

Using Instruments is especially helpful for apps that process large amounts of data or use advanced features such as video, maps, artificial intelligence, or real-time communication.

8. TestFlight: Beta Testing Before Launch

TestFlight allows developers to share pre-release app builds with internal and external testers. Testers can use the application, report problems, and provide feedback before the public launch.

This makes TestFlight an important part of iOS app development services because it helps teams improve stability and user experience before publishing the final version.
